How Controversies Begin in the Digital Age

Unlike the past, controversies no longer depend on traditional media. Social platforms amplify every action within seconds. A leaked video, an old tweet, or a misunderstood comment can spark outrage overnight.

Common causes of celebrity controversies include:

Inappropriate social media posts Legal disputes or allegations Public relationship conflicts Brand endorsement backlash

The speed at which information spreads makes damage control extremely challenging.

Career Impact: Short-Term Shock, Long-Term Consequences

When a controversy breaks out, the immediate effects are often severe. Brands withdraw endorsements, projects are paused, and public image suffers. For some celebrities, this phase becomes a temporary setback, while for others it leads to long-term career damage.

However, not all controversies end careers. Public perception often depends on how a celebrity responds—silence, denial, or accountability can shape the outcome.

Public Apologies and Image Repair

In recent times, public apologies have become a common response. A well-crafted apology that shows responsibility and growth can help rebuild trust. Celebrities who accept mistakes and demonstrate change often regain audience support.

On the other hand, defensive behavior or repeated mistakes can permanently damage credibility.
